SynopsisA New York Times Bestseller -- Sable, a bestselling novelist haunted by her past; Elly, a lonely academic; Barbara Ann, a romance writer whose life is out of control; and Beth, a mystery author and abused wife. Drawn together by the loss of a close friend, these four women spend a summer sorting through her personal effects. And in the house on Olive Street, away from their troubles, the women discover something marvelous: themselves., After the death of a close friend, four women (all writers) gather at her house for a weekend to sort through her personal papers, as well as to come to terms with what their own lives have become.
